Jackson v. Vaughan & Bushnell Manufacturing Co
Plaintiff: Kory C Jackson, Sr
Defendant: Vaughan & Bushnell Manufacturing Co
Case Number: 1:2014cv01211
Filed: June 3, 2014
Court: US District Court for the Central District of Illinois
Office: Peoria Office
County: McDonough
Presiding Judge: Jonathan E. Hawley
Presiding Judge: James E. Shadid
Nature of Suit: Employment
Cause of Action: 42 U.S.C. ยง 2000
Jury Demanded By: None

Available Case Documents

The following documents for this case are available for you to view or download:

Date Filed Document Text
August 4, 2015 Opinion or Order Filing 21 ORDER AND OPINION granting 14 Dft Vaughan & Bushnell Motion for Summary Judgment. This matter is now terminated, and existing deadlines are vacated. See full Order and Opinion attached. Entered by Chief Judge James E. Shadid on 8/4/2015. (RK, ilcd)
